3 When the people heard this ·teaching [law; instruction; L Torah], they ·separated [excluded; removed] all foreigners [C including people of mixed ancestry] from Israel.
Nehemiah Returns to Jerusalem
4 Before that happened, Eliashib the priest, who was ·in charge of [appointed over] the ·Temple [L house] storerooms, was ·friendly with [or a relative of] Tobiah. 5 Eliashib let Tobiah use one of the large storerooms. Earlier it had been used for ·grain [L gift; tribute] offerings [Lev. 2:3], incense, the ·utensils [vessels], and the ·tenth offerings [tithes] of grain, new wine, and olive oil ·that belonged to [commanded/prescribed for] the Levites, singers, and gatekeepers. It had also been used for ·gifts [contributions; offerings] for the priests.
